AVAILABLE WITH VACANT POSSESSION IS THIS REAR FACING TERRACE HOUSE WITH ACCOMMODATION ARRANGED OVER THREE FLOORS TOGETHER WITH A SOUTH FACING GARDEN. The property would be ideal for someone looking to take their first steps on to the property ladder and is located within this ever-popular residential area close to a host of amenities including shops, restaurants, bars, the Royal Infirmary and accessible for both town centre and M62 motorway. The accommodation is served by a gas central heating system, PVCu double glazing and briefly comprises to the ground floor, entrance lobby and spacious well proportioned living room. Lower ground floor kitchen and dining area, first floor two bedrooms and bathroom. Externally there is on street permit parking and low maintenance flagged south facing garden. ENTRANCE HALL

A PVCu and frosted double glazed door opens into an entrance lobby this has a frosted PVCu double glazed window above the door providing additional natural light, ceiling light point, central heating radiator and feature arch at the foot of the stairs which rise to the first floor. To one side a door opens into the living room.

LIVING ROOM

Dimensions: 4.62m x 4.47m (15'2 x 14'8). As the dimensions indicate this is a well-proportioned room which has a PVCu double glazed window, ceiling light point, picture rail, central heating radiator and as the main focal point of the room there is a fireplace with electric fire. From the living room a door gives access to a staircase leading down to the lower ground floor.

KITCHEN

Dimensions: 4.39m x 2.21m (14'5 x 7'3). With a PVCu double glazed window and a range of base and wall cupboards, drawers, contrasting overlying timber effect worktops with matching splashbacks, there is a single drainer stainless steel sink with chrome mixer tap, four ring stainless steel gas hob with stainless steel extractor hood over and stainless steel electric oven beneath, space for fridge freezer, plumbing for automatic washing machine and cupboard housing an Ideal gas fired central heating boiler, there are inset ceiling downlighters and to one side a dining area.

DINING AREA

Dimensions: 1.98m x 1.52m (6'6 x 5'0). With a central heating radiator and inset ceiling downlighters.

FIRST FLOOR LANDING

With useful storage cupboard to one side, ceiling light point and loft access. From the landing access can be gained to the following:-

BEDROOM ONE

Dimensions: 3.28m x 2.92m (10'9 x 9'7). With a PVCu double glazed window, ceiling light point, central heating radiator and chimney breast.

BEDROOM TWO

Dimensions: 2.67m x 2.49m (8'9 x 8'2). This is situated adjacent to bedroom one and has a ceiling light point and central heating radiator.

BATHROOM

Dimensions: 3.51m x 1.42m (11'6 x 4'8). With a ceiling light point, central heating radiator, part tiled walls and fitted with a suite comprising panelled bath with glazed shower screen and with a shower fitting over, pedestal wash basin and low flush w.c.

Garden

The property has a south facing low maintenance flagged garden. There is on street permit parking.

    Broadband availability and predicted speed

    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:

    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
    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
    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s

    The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2

    Mobile phone signal availability and predicted strength

    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:

    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
    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
    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
    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
    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
